    Squamous cell carcinoma of the breast: a case report

    <p>Abstract</p> <p>Background</p> <p>Squamous cells are normally not found inside the breast, so a primary squamous cell carcinoma of the breast is an exceptional phenomenon. There is a possible explanation for these findings.</p> <p>Case presentation</p> <p>A 72-year-old woman presented with a breast abnormality suspected for breast carcinoma. After the operation the pathological examination revealed a primary squamous cell carcinoma of the breast.</p> <p>Conclusion</p> <p>The presentation of squamous cell carcinoma could be similar to that of an adenocarcinoma. However, a squamous cell carcinoma of the breast could also develop from a complicated breast cyst or abscess. Therefore, pathological examination of these apparent benign abnormalities is mandatory.</p

    Signet Ring Cell Carcinoma of the Ampulla of Vater:A Rare Histopathological Variant

    Signet ring cell carcinoma (SRCC) of the ampulla of Vater is an extremely rare tumor. Our case describes a 45-year-old female presenting with jaundice and pruritus. Computed tomography, endoscopy, and endoscopic retrograde cholangiopancreatography showed a tumor of the ampulla of Vater without distant metastasis. Histological biopsy confirmed a malignant tumor with SRCC characteristics and immunohistochemical staining revealed a mixed type profile (both intestinal and pancreatobiliary characteristics). A pylorus-preserving pancreatoduodenectomy was performed and the patient recovered without complications. Pathology results concluded a pT2N0 ampullary SRCC. SRCC of the ampulla of Vater is known to be highly malignant. After 13 months of follow-up, our patient showed no signs of recurrence

    Short-Term Outcomes of Secondary Liver Surgery for Initially Unresectable Colorectal Liver Metastases following Modern Induction Systemic Therapy in the Dutch CAIRO5 Trial

    Objective: To present short-term outcomes of liver surgery in patients with initially unresectable colorectal liver metastases (CRLM) downsized by chemotherapy plus targeted agents. Background: The increase of complex hepatic resections of CRLM, technical innovations pushing boundaries of respectability, and use of intensified induction systemic regimens warrant for safety data in a homogeneous multicenter prospective cohort. Methods: Patients with initially unresectable CRLM, who underwent complete resection after induction systemic regimens with doublet or triplet chemotherapy, both plus targeted therapy, were selected from the ongoing phase III CAIRO5 study (NCT02162563). Short-term outcomes and risk factors for severe postoperative morbidity (Clavien Dindo grade ≥ 3) were analyzed using logistic regression analysis. Results: A total of 173 patients underwent resection of CRLM after induction systemic therapy. The median number of metastases was 9 and 161 (93%) patients had bilobar disease. Thirty-six (20.8%) 2-stage resections and 88 (51%) major resections (>3 liver segments) were performed. Severe postoperative morbidity and 90-day mortality was 15.6% and 2.9%, respectively. After multivariable analysis, blood transfusion (odds ratio [OR] 2.9 [95% confidence interval (CI) 1.1-6.4], P = 0.03), major resection (OR 2.9 [95% CI 1.1-7.5], P = 0.03), and triplet chemotherapy (OR 2.6 [95% CI 1.1-7.5], P = 0.03) were independently correlated with severe postoperative complications. No association was found between number of cycles of systemic therapy and severe complications (r = -0.038, P = 0.31). Conclusion: In patients with initially unresectable CRLM undergoing modern induction systemic therapy and extensive liver surgery, severe postoperative morbidity and 90-day mortality were 15.6% and 2.7%, respectively. Triplet chemotherapy, blood transfusion, and major resections were associated with severe postoperative morbidity

    Hospital variation and outcomes of simultaneous resection of primary colorectal tumour and liver metastases:a population-based study

    BACKGROUND: The optimal treatment sequence for patients with synchronous colorectal liver metastases (CRLM) remains uncertain. This study aimed to assess factors associated with the use of simultaneous resections and impact on hospital variation. METHOD: This population-based study included all patients who underwent liver surgery for synchronous colorectal liver metastases between 2014 and 2019 in the Netherlands. Factors associated with simultaneous resection were identified. Short-term surgical outcomes of simultaneous resections and factors associated with 30-day major morbidity were evaluated. RESULTS: Of 2146 patients included, 589 (27%) underwent simultaneous resection in 28 hospitals. Simultaneous resection was associated with age, sex, BMI, number, size and bilobar distribution of CRLM, and administration of preoperative chemotherapy. More minimally invasive and minor resections were performed in the simultaneous group. Hospital variation was present (range 2.4%-83.3%) with several hospitals performing simultaneous procedures more and less frequently than expected. Simultaneous resection resulted in 13% 30-day major morbidity, and 1% mortality. ASA classification ≥3 was independently associated with higher 30-day major morbidity after simultaneous resection (aOR 1.97, CI 1.10-3.42, p = 0.018). CONCLUSION: Distinctive patient and tumour characteristics influence the choice for simultaneous resection. Remarkable hospital variation is present in the Netherlands

    Factors associated with failure to rescue after liver resection and impact on hospital variation:a nationwide population-based study

    BACKGROUND: Failure to rescue (FTR) is defined as postoperative complications leading to mortality. This nationwide study aimed to assess factors associated with FTR and hospital variation in FTR after liver surgery. METHODS: All patients who underwent liver resection between 2014 and 2017 in the Netherlands were included. FTR was defined as in-hospital or 30-day mortality after complications Dindo grade ≥3a. Variables associated with FTR and nationwide hospital variation were assessed using multivariable logistic regression. RESULTS: Of 4961 patients included, 3707 (74.4%) underwent liver resection for colorectal liver metastases, 379 (7.6%) for other metastases, 526 (10.6%) for hepatocellular carcinoma and 349 (7.0%) for biliary cancer. Thirty-day major morbidity was 11.5%. Overall mortality was 2.3%. FTR was 19.1%. Age 65-80 (aOR: 2.86, CI:1.01-12.0, p = 0.049), ASA 3+ (aOR:2.59, CI: 1.66-4.02, p < 0.001), liver cirrhosis (aOR:4.15, CI:1.81-9.22, p < 0.001), biliary cancer (aOR:3.47, CI: 1.73-6.96, p < 0.001), and major resection (aOR:6.46, CI: 3.91-10.9, p < 0.001) were associated with FTR. Postoperative liver failure (aOR: 26.9, CI: 14.6-51.2, p < 0.001), cardiac (aOR: 2.62, CI: 1.27-5.29, p = 0.008) and thromboembolic complications (aOR: 2.49, CI: 1.16-5.22, p = 0.017) were associated with FTR. After case-mix correction, no hospital variation in FTR was observed. CONCLUSION: FTR is influenced by patient demographics, disease and procedural burden. Prevention of postoperative liver failure, cardiac and thromboembolic complications could decrease FTR

    Hospital variation and outcomes after repeat hepatic resection for colorectal liver metastases:a nationwide cohort study

    Background: Approximately 70% of patients with colorectal liver metastases (CRLM) experiences intrahepatic recurrence after initial liver resection. This study assessed outcomes and hospital variation in repeat liver resections (R-LR).Methods: This population-based study included all patients who underwent liver resection for CRLM between 2014 and 2022 in the Netherlands. Overall survival (OS) was collected for patients operated on between 2014 and 2018 by linkage to the insurance database. Results: Data of 7479 liver resections (1391 (18.6%) repeat and 6088 (81.4%) primary) were analysed. Major morbidity and mortality were not different. Factors associated with major morbidity included ASA 3+, major liver resection, extrahepatic disease, and open surgery. Five-year OS after repeat versus primary liver resection was 42.3% versus 44.8%, P = 0.37. Factors associated with worse OS included largest CRLM &gt;5 cm (aHR 1.58, 95% CI: 1.07–2.34, P = 0.023), &gt;3 CRLM (aHR 1.33, 95% CI: 1.00–1.75, P = 0.046), extrahepatic disease (aHR 1.60, 95% CI: 1.25–2.04, P = 0.001), positive tumour margins (aHR 1.42, 95% CI: 1.09–1.85, P = 0.009). Significant hospital variation in performance of R-LR was observed, median 18.9% (8.2% to 33.3%).Conclusion: Significant hospital variation was observed in performance of R-LR in the Netherlands reflecting different treatment decisions upon recurrence. On a population-based level R-LR leads to satisfactory survival.</p

    Outcomes of liver surgery:A decade of mandatory nationwide auditing in the Netherlands

    Background: In 2013, the nationwide Dutch Hepato Biliary Audit (DHBA) was initiated. The aim of this study was to evaluate changes in indications for and outcomes of liver surgery in the last decade. Methods: This nationwide study included all patients who underwent liver surgery for four indications, including colorectal liver metastases (CRLM), hepatocellular carcinoma (HCC), and intrahepatic– and perihilar cholangiocarcinoma (iCCA – pCCA) between 2014 and 2022. Trends in postoperative outcomes were evaluated separately for each indication using multilevel multivariable logistic regression analyses. Results: This study included 8057 procedures for CRLM, 838 for HCC, 290 for iCCA, and 300 for pCCA. Over time, these patients had higher risk profiles (more ASA-III patients and more comorbidities). Adjusted mortality decreased over time for CRLM, HCC and iCCA, respectively aOR 0.83, 95%CI 0.75–0.92, P &lt; 0.001; aOR 0.86, 95%CI 0.75–0.99, P = 0.045; aOR 0.40, 95%CI 0.20–0.73, P &lt; 0.001. Failure to rescue (FTR) also decreased for these groups, respectively aOR 0.84, 95%CI 0.76–0.93, P = 0.001; aOR 0.81, 95%CI 0.68–0.97, P = 0.024; aOR 0.29, 95%CI 0.08–0.84, P = 0.021). For iCCA severe complications (aOR 0.65 95%CI 0.43–0.99, P = 0.043) also decreased. No significant outcome differences were observed in pCCA. The number of centres performing liver resections decreased from 26 to 22 between 2014 and 2022, while median annual volumes did not change (40–49, P = 0.66). Conclusion: Over time, postoperative mortality and FTR decreased after liver surgery, despite treating higher-risk patients. The DHBA continues its focus on providing feedback and benchmark results to further enhance outcomes.</p

    Impact of complications after resection of pancreatic cancer on disease recurrence and survival, and mediation effect of adjuvant chemotherapy:nationwide, observational cohort study

    Background: The causal pathway between complications after pancreatic cancer resection and impaired long-term survival remains unknown. The aim of this study was to investigate the impact of complications after pancreatic cancer resection on disease-free interval and overall survival, with adjuvant chemotherapy as a mediator.Methods: This observational study included all patients undergoing pancreatic cancer resection in the Netherlands (2014-2017). Clinical data were extracted from the prospective Dutch Pancreatic Cancer Audit. Recurrence and survival data were collected additionally. In causal mediation analysis, direct and indirect effect estimates via adjuvant chemotherapy were calculated.Results: In total, 1071 patients were included. Major complications (hazards ratio 1.22 (95 per cent c.i. 1.04 to 1.43); P = 0.015 and hazards ratio 1.25 (95 per cent c.i. 1.08 to 1.46); P = 0.003) and organ failure (hazards ratio 1.86 (95 per cent c.i. 1.32 to 2.62); P &lt; 0.001 and hazards ratio 1.89 (95 per cent c.i. 1.36 to 2.63); P &lt; 0.001) were associated with shorter disease-free interval and overall survival respectively. The effects of major complications and organ failure on disease-free interval (-1.71 (95 per cent c.i. -2.27 to -1.05) and -3.05 (95 per cent c.i. -4.03 to -1.80) respectively) and overall survival (-1.92 (95 per cent c.i. -2.60 to -1.16) and -3.49 (95 per cent c.i. -4.84 to -2.03) respectively) were mediated by adjuvant chemotherapy. Additionally, organ failure directly affected disease-free interval (-5.38 (95 per cent c.i. -9.27 to -1.94)) and overall survival (-6.32 (95 per cent c.i. -10.43 to -1.99)). In subgroup analyses, the association was found in patients undergoing pancreaticoduodenectomy, but not in patients undergoing distal pancreatectomy.Conclusion: Major complications, including organ failure, negatively impact survival in patients after pancreatic cancer resection, largely mediated by adjuvant chemotherapy. Prevention or adequate treatment of complications and use of neoadjuvant treatment may improve oncological outcomes.</p
